Félienne Frederieke Johanna Hermans (/Fay-lee-nuh/, born 1984)[2] is a scientist and Professor at Vrije Universiteit Amsterdam.[3][4][5] Her research interests include programming education[6][7][8][9] and end-user computing[1] particularly spreadsheets.[10][11][12][13][14]

Education edit

Hermans received her Master of Science degree in computer science from Eindhoven University of Technology,[when?][citation needed] and her PhD in software engineering in 2013 from Delft University of Technology.[15]

Career and research edit

After her PhD, she was appointed an assistant professor at Delft University of Technology,[16][17] heading the Spreadsheet Lab.[18]

As of 2024 Hermans is head of the Programming Education Research Lab (PERL).[19]

Hermans is the founder and former CEO of Infotron, a research spin-off company of TU Delft that implements risk assessment software for spreadsheets.[citation needed]

Hermans is active with DigiLeerkracht, the computational thinking teaching by Future.nl,[20] and teaches programming,[21] including one day a week at the Lyceum Kralingen in Rotterdam.[22] In addition, Hermans is a referee at the FIRST Lego League Challenge, where children build a robot from Lego.[23] [24] She served as a board member at Devnology Nederland,[25] an organisation for software developers. She is a co-organiser of the yearly conference Joy of Coding.[26]

Outreach edit

In 2011, Hermans gave a TEDx talk in Delft.[27] Hermans has given research talks at conferences including StrangeLoop,[28] NDC,[29][30][31] GOTO,[32][33][34] and DDD Europe,[35] a conference about domain-driven design. Since 2016, she is a host of SE Radio.[36][37]

Hermans produced several Massive open online courses (MOOCs) on edX, with topics including programming in Scratch for teachers and children.[38] She self-published an e-book about the creation of games for children.[39] In 2017, she started a program for Rotterdam elementary students to receive programming lessons.[40] In 2020, Hermans launched the Hedy programming language, to teach children to use the Python programming language.[41][42]

She is the author of The Programmer's Brain: What every programmer needs to know about cognition.[6]

Awards and honours edit

Hermans' online data analysis course was awarded the Wharton-QS gold education award for best education innovation project entry in Europe.[43][44][45][better source needed]

Hermans won the SURF Education Award in 2017, SURF being the collaborative Information and communications technology (ICT) organisation for Dutch education and research.[46][47][48][49]

In 2018, the Open Education Consortium awarded her the Open Education Award for Excellence.[50] Also in 2018, Hermans won the Tech Inspirator Award at the Techionista Awards.[51]
